Pots of advice from Mark Williams

Learn to pot the ball like Mark Williams



First, you've got to be able to sight the ball well.

Basically, that's knowing what will and won't pot.

Then, you've got to stay steady on the shot - don't take a flyer at it because your cue action will just go to pieces.

And thirdly - make sure you pot it! It might be a while before you get another chance!

There are several drills you can use to practice.

The easiest is just to set up the cue ball and object ball for a particular shot then practice it six or seven times.

Try to understand how you are aiming and playing the shot.

If you're playing in and around the black ball, it's more about control and touch - and knowing how fast the table is.

Long potting is all about confidence - and good eyesight!

Think positive!

If you're feeling down or lacking a bit of confidence, your game goes.

You start thinking about the balls you might miss more than the ones you are going to pot.

Snooker is all about keeping the same action for every shot, regardless of what type of shot it is.

It's about good technique. Get that right, and the rest of your game follows.
